Output 4e66ee88a33a20654713b98a43f4136d213021fcf4dab19b102faccd1febfeb8:30

value
25183220
script pubkey
OP_0 OP_PUSHBYTES_20 ee644e2ada6bb64c24fb1c121674e4ac381f34d1
address
bc1qaejyu2k6dwmycf8mrsfpva8y4sup7dx33m322y
transaction
4e66ee88a33a20654713b98a43f4136d213021fcf4dab19b102faccd1febfeb8
spent
true